Understanding Civil Marriages

Civil marriages represent a legally binding union between two persons, accepted by the state. They differ from religious ceremonies, as they are mainly focused on legal aspects. In a civil marriage, couples vow their commitment before a judge, and the ceremony usually involves the exchange of rings. After the ceremony, the couple receives a license that officially establishes their marital status.

Secular Wedding Ceremonies: A Guide

Planning a wedding that reflects your values without religious rituals can be rewarding. Secular ceremonies are personalized, allowing you to celebrate love in a way that feels true to you. A secular ceremony typically emphasizes the couple's bond, mariage net often incorporating symbolic readings, poems, or personal vows.

Consider these elements to craft a ceremony that is truly your own:

* **Officiant:** Choose someone who resonates with your values and can guide the ceremony with warmth and sincerity.

* **Location:** Select a venue that embodies your style and vision, whether it's an outdoor setting, a historic building, or a contemporary space.

* **Readings & Vows:** Feature personal poems that communicate the depth of your love and commitment.

* **Rituals:** Create special moments that hold importance for you as a couple.

Crafting the Right Vows: Civil vs. Religious

When embarking on your marriage journey, one of the most meaningful decisions you'll make is crafting your vows. These copyright express your commitment and intention to your partner, forming a forever bond.

Choosing between civil and religious vows can pose unique options.

Civil ceremonies typically involve secular vows, highlighting the formal aspects of the marriage. They enable you to personalize your vows to reflect your individual beliefs and values.

On religious ceremonies usually involve vows that conform with the beliefs of a specific religion. These vows can feature sacred texts and represent the divine nature of the union.

Ultimately, the best choice depends on your unique beliefs, values, and the atmosphere you desire to create for your wedding day. No matter you choose civil or religious vows, keep in mind that the most important aspect is the commitment you express with your partner.
